Scruggs v. ExxonMobil Pension Plan, 08-6145
In an ERISA action seeking retroactive pension and savings benefits allegedly owed to plaintiff under two of defendants' employee benefits plans, summary judgment for defendants is affirmed where the plan administrator's denial of plaintiff's claim for benefits was not arbitrary or capricious because, inter alia, plaintiff was ineligible for benefits under the Plans as an independent contractor.
